Orange County, FL Contractor/Performance/Compliance Bond
Overview
Orange County requires contractors to carry this bond before they can pull permits or register to work within the county's jurisdiction. It protects Orange County and the public against incomplete work, code violations, and contractor non-compliance on permitted projects. This is a local county requirement — it is not your Florida state contractor license bond. If you are doing permitted work in Orange County, FL, this bond is part of the package.
Who Needs This Bond?
Contractors working in Orange County, FL who need to register locally or pull county permits must carry this bond. That includes general contractors, residential contractors, and specialty trades operating under an Orange County permit. If Orange County's building or licensing department has told you that you need a compliance or performance bond to get registered or permitted, this is the bond you are looking at. It applies whether you are a sole proprietor or a licensed business entity doing work anywhere in unincorporated Orange County or within its permitting jurisdiction.
What is this Bond For?
Orange County's Contractor/Performance/Compliance Bond guarantees that a contractor will perform permitted work according to county codes, complete the scope of work, and meet all local compliance requirements. If a contractor abandons a project, violates county ordinances, or fails to correct deficient work, the bond provides a financial remedy for Orange County or an aggrieved property owner. This bond is about accountability — it gives Orange County a mechanism to act when a contractor does not hold up their end of a permitted job.

Where Does it Apply?
This bond is specific to Orange County, Florida. It satisfies a county-level requirement and does not carry over to work done in neighboring jurisdictions like Orlando, Osceola County, or Seminole County. If you are working across multiple Florida counties, each jurisdiction may have its own bonding requirement.
